Overview

Varicose veins are enlarged veins that appear superficially on the surface of the skin. They mostly occur on the legs and lower body due to prolonged standing and excessive pressure on the veins in the lower body.

Varicose veins may not cause any problems or need treatment. Treatment is recommended when there is excessive pain and discomfort. Some people like to get treatment due to aesthetic reasons.

A varicose veins surgery is recommended for patients if:

  • The veins are bleeding through the skin
  • There is ulceration due to varicose veins
  • The veins have enlarged due to inflammation (phlebitis) and are painful
  • Other treatments are not suitable for the condition

What is varicose vein surgery?

The surgical treatment for varicose veins is known as ligation and stripping. The technique involves tying up the affected vein and then removing it.

The surgeon makes two incisions – the first incision is made near the groin and the other one is done around the knee.

The faulty vein is tied up through the groin incision to stop the blood flow. This process is called ligation. Through the second incision, a flexible wire is inserted to pull out the vein through a process called stripping.

Factors to consider to estimate the cost of varicose vein surgery

There are a few factors you must consider to assess the overall cost of your surgery:

Type of treatment

The type of treatment you are undergoing also determines the overall cost. Certain procedures like radiofrequency ablation or endovenous laser treatment will be less costly than ligation and stripping surgery.

Hospital selection

The type of hospital also determines your overall surgical expenditure. Private super-specialty hospitals use innovative technologies, have better infrastructure, and provide personalized one-to-one care which is costlier compared to government hospitals.

Hospital charges

Hospital charges consist of the following:

  • Diagnostic costs
  • Room charges
  • Rent of operation theatre
  • Hospital stays
  • Post-op cost and nursing care
  • Cost of the surgical team and anaesthesiologist
  • Surgeon’s fees
  • Technology used in the surgery
  • Medications

A single-room occupancy will be costlier than a double-room or a triple-share room. Hospital stays in government hospitals are cheaper compared to private hospitals. If you have some health issues or have developed post-op complications, you may need additional stays in the hospitals which increases the overall cost of the surgery.

The charges of a highly skilled and experienced surgeon will be more than a less experienced surgeon.

Insurance coverage

If you are medically insured, it will reduce or cover the total bill payment at the hospital. It can pay for your hospital charges, medication, and operation costs. Selecting a good insurance provider ensures better hospital discounts and minimizing unexpected expenses.

Diagnostic tests

Diagnostic tests consist of blood tests and other imaging studies pre- and post-operation. Expenses in private hospitals with specialized settings are more than in government hospitals.

Post-surgical complications

Some people may develop unexpected complications after surgery that will require additional treatments and hospital stays. This will increase the total hospital bill.

Severity of the disease

If the disease is severe, you may need additional treatment and intensive care that will add up to your total cost.

Post-surgical care

Post-surgical care at home is crucial for proper recovery from the surgery. Post-op care includes prescribed medications, homecare, nursing services, follow-up consultations with the doctor, diagnostic tests to monitor recovery, etc.

What is the cost of varicose vein surgery in Bangalore?

The cost of varicose vein surgery can be anywhere between Rs. 85,000 to Rs. 1,65,000. It depends on the type of treatment you are having, your overall health, the severity of the disease, medications, hospital stays, etc.
